When it comes to computer repair in Huntsville, AL, finding a reliable and efficient service provider is crucial. From hardware issues to software glitches, a malfunctioning computer can disrupt both personal and professional aspects of your life. Therefore, understanding the various aspects of computer repair, the common problems faced by users, and the best practices for finding a reputable repair service is essential. In this comprehensive guide, we will delve into the world of computer repair in Huntsville, AL, offering you detailed insights and reliable solutions to ensure your computer runs smoothly.

Table of Contents

Common Computer Problems and Their Causes

Computers are complex machines that can encounter various issues. Understanding the common problems and their underlying causes will help you identify and address them effectively. One of the most prevalent issues is slow performance, which can be caused by a lack of system maintenance, excessive background processes, or outdated hardware. Another common problem is sudden crashes or freezes, which can be attributed to software conflicts, driver issues, or hardware failures.

Slow Performance: Identifying the Culprits

When experiencing sluggish performance, there are several possible culprits to consider. The first step is to check for excessive background processes that may be consuming system resources. Use the Task Manager to identify resource-hogging applications and close them if necessary. Additionally, outdated hardware, such as insufficient RAM or an old hard drive, can significantly impact performance. Upgrading these components may be necessary to improve speed and responsiveness.

Sudden Crashes: Resolving Software Conflicts

If your computer crashes or freezes unexpectedly, software conflicts may be to blame. Conflicting programs or incompatible drivers can cause system instability. To resolve this, update all software and drivers to their latest versions. If the problem persists, try uninstalling recently installed programs or performing a clean boot to identify the specific software causing the conflict. If all else fails, seeking professional help may be necessary to diagnose and fix any underlying hardware issues.

DIY Computer Repair: What You Should Know

While some computer repairs require professional expertise, there are certain tasks that you can tackle on your own. Understanding the basics of DIY computer repair can save you time and money. However, it is crucial to know your limitations and when to seek professional help to avoid causing further damage.

Basic Troubleshooting Techniques

Before diving into more complex repairs, start with basic troubleshooting techniques. Restarting your computer can often resolve minor software glitches. If that doesn’t work, try running a virus scan to check for malware that may be affecting performance. Clearing temporary files, updating software, and checking for available system updates are other simple yet effective troubleshooting steps.

Safe Hardware Repairs

Some hardware repairs can be safely performed by inexperienced users. For example, replacing a faulty keyboard, upgrading RAM or adding a new hard drive are relatively straightforward tasks with plenty of online resources and tutorials available. However, always follow safety precautions and make sure to power off and unplug your computer before attempting any hardware repairs.

Choosing the Right Computer Repair Service in Huntsville, AL

When faced with complex computer issues or repairs beyond your expertise, it is essential to choose a reputable computer repair service in Huntsville, AL. Consider the following factors when selecting a service provider:

Reputation and Experience

Research the reputation and experience of various computer repair services in Huntsville, AL. Look for customer reviews and testimonials to gauge their level of satisfaction. Ideally, choose a service provider with a proven track record and positive feedback from previous clients.

Pricing and Warranty

Compare pricing structures among different repair services, ensuring they offer transparent and competitive rates. Additionally, inquire about warranty policies and guarantees for the repairs undertaken. A reliable repair service will stand behind their work and provide a reasonable warranty period.

Turnaround Time and Communication

Consider the turnaround time offered by the repair service. While it may vary depending on the complexity of the issue, choose a provider that offers a reasonable timeframe for repairs. Additionally, good communication is crucial throughout the repair process. Ensure the service provider is responsive and keeps you informed about the progress of your computer repair.

Hardware Repair: Fixing Common Issues

Hardware issues can range from minor annoyances to critical failures. Understanding how to diagnose and resolve common hardware problems will help you determine when professional assistance is necessary and potentially save you money on unnecessary repairs.

Power Supply Unit (PSU) Failure

A faulty power supply unit can cause your computer to shut down unexpectedly or fail to power on. To diagnose a PSU failure, first, check if the power cable is properly connected. If the issue persists, try using a different power outlet or testing the PSU with a multimeter. However, if you are unsure or uncomfortable dealing with electrical components, it is best to leave PSU repairs to professionals.

Malfunctioning Hard Drives

A malfunctioning hard drive can lead to data loss and system instability. Symptoms of a failing hard drive include slow file access, unusual noises, and frequent system crashes. To diagnose hard drive issues, use diagnostic tools such as CrystalDiskInfo or HD Tune. If the hard drive is failing, it is crucial to back up your data immediately and seek professional help for repair or replacement.

Software Repair: Troubleshooting Common Glitches

Software-related issues can cause frustration and hinder productivity. Knowing how to troubleshoot common software glitches will enable you to resolve them efficiently and get your computer back on track.

Operating System Errors

Operating system errors can manifest in various ways, including blue screen errors, constant system freezes, or applications failing to launch. Start by running a system file checker to scan and repair corrupted system files. If the issue persists, consider performing a system restore to a previous stable state. In extreme cases, reinstalling the operating system may be necessary.

Software Conflicts and Compatibility Issues

Conflicting software or incompatible programs can cause system instability and crashes. Start by updating all software to their latest versions, ensuring compatibility with your operating system. If the issue persists, uninstall recently installed software or use a clean boot to identify the specific program causing the conflict. Seeking professional assistance may be necessary for more complex software conflicts.

Data Recovery: Salvaging Lost Files

Accidental file deletion or hard drive failure can result in the loss of important data. Understanding data recovery methods and tools can help you retrieve your lost files and minimize the impact of data loss.

Deleted File Recovery

If you accidentally delete a file, the first step is to check your recycle bin or trash folder, as files are often temporarily stored there. If the file is not there, you can use data recovery software such as Recuva or TestDisk to scan for and recover deleted files. However, avoid installing recovery software on the same drive to prevent overwriting the deleted files.

Hard Drive Failure Recovery

If your hard drive fails, professional assistance may be necessary for data recovery. Attempting to recover data from a failed hard drive without proper expertise or equipment can lead to further damage. Contact a reputable data recovery service in Huntsville, AL, to assess the situation and retrieve your valuable files.

Upgrading Your Computer: Boosting Performance

If your computer is struggling to keep up with modern demands, upgrading certain components can significantly enhance its performance. Understanding the upgrade options available and choosing the right components for your needs will help you maximize your computer’s capabilities.

RAM Upgrade

Upgrading your computer’s RAM (Random Access Memory) can improve multitasking capabilities and overall system performance. Determine the maximum RAM capacity your motherboard supports and choose compatible RAM modules. Install the new RAM carefully, following proper installation techniques, and enjoy the increased speed and responsiveness of your computer.

Storage Upgrade

Replacing your traditional hard drive with a solid-state drive (SSD) can drastically improve your computer’s boot time and file access speed. SSDs offer faster read and write speeds compared to traditional hard drives, resulting in a more responsive system. Clone your existing hard drive or perform a clean installation of the operating system onto the SSD for optimal results.

Preventive Maintenance: Keeping Your Computer Healthy

Regular maintenance can prevent many common computer problems from occurring in the first place. Implementing preventive measures will help keep your computer healthy and extend its lifespan.

Regular Cleaning and Dusting

Dust accumulation can cause overheating and hinder proper airflow within your computer. Regularly clean the internal components, including fans, vents, and heat sinks, using compressed air or a soft brush. Additionally, keep your workspace clean to minimize dust intake and prevent it from settling on your computer.

System Optimization and Updates

Regularly update your operating system, drivers, and software to ensure you have the latest security patches and bug fixes. These updates often improve system stability and performance. Additionally, optimize your computer’s startup programs and disable unnecessary background processes to reduce system resource consumption.

Frequently Asked Questions about Computer Repair in Huntsville, AL

Here are answers to some commonly asked questions regarding computer repair in Huntsville, AL:1. How much does computer repair in Huntsville, AL typically cost?

The cost of computer repair in Huntsville, AL can vary depending on the nature of the problem and the service provider. Simple repairs such as software troubleshooting or virus removal may cost around $50 to $100. However, more complex repairs like hardware replacement or data recovery can range from $100 to several hundred dollars. It is recommended to obtain quotes from multiple repair services and inquire about any additional fees or charges to ensure transparency in pricing.

2. How long does computer repair usually take?

The duration of computer repair depends on the complexity of the issue and the workload of the repair service. Minor software repairs can typically be resolved within a few hours to a day, while hardware repairs or data recovery may take several days or even weeks, depending on the specific circumstances. It is advisable to discuss the estimated turnaround time with the repair service before proceeding.

3. Will my data be safe during the repair process?

A reputable computer repair service in Huntsville, AL should prioritize data security and confidentiality. However, it is always wise to back up your important files before handing over your computer for repair. Additionally, inquire about the repair service’s data protection policies and whether they have measures in place to safeguard customer data during the repair process.

4. Should I repair or replace my computer?

Deciding whether to repair or replace your computer depends on various factors, including the extent of the damage, the age of the computer, and your budget. If the repair cost is significantly high and your computer is outdated or experiencing multiple hardware failures, it may be more cost-effective to invest in a new computer. However, for minor repairs or if your computer is relatively new, repairing it can extend its lifespan and save you money.

5. How can I prevent future computer problems?

Preventive measures are essential for maintaining a healthy computer. Here are some tips to prevent future problems:

Regularly update your operating system, drivers, and software to ensure you have the latest bug fixes and security patches.

Install reputable antivirus software and perform regular scans to detect and remove malware.

Back up your important data regularly to an external storage device or cloud-based service.

Avoid downloading or installing suspicious software or clicking on unknown links.

Keep your computer’s hardware and components clean and free from dust.

Use surge protectors or uninterruptible power supplies (UPS) to protect your computer from power surges.

Practice safe browsing habits and be cautious when opening email attachments or visiting unfamiliar websites.


In conclusion, understanding the various aspects of computer repair in Huntsville, AL is crucial for maintaining a reliable and efficient computer system. By familiarizing yourself with common computer problems, troubleshooting techniques, and preventive measures, you can save time and money by resolving minor issues on your own. However, for complex problems or hardware repairs beyond your expertise, it is advisable to seek the assistance of a reputable computer repair service in Huntsville, AL. Remember to consider factors such as reputation, pricing, and turnaround time when choosing a service provider. With the insights provided in this comprehensive guide, you can confidently navigate the world of computer repair in Huntsville, AL and ensure your computer runs smoothly for years to come.

